Trying my fair share of protein bars, I’ve got a lot to compare these too. Unlike your standard shop bought chocolate bars, Protein bars are a lot chewier, and these are no exception. For some, that’s a good thing, for others, it’s not so. It totally depends on your preference. For me, a chewier bar lasts longer and keeps me fuller for longer, so I’m pretty happy with the chewy texture.

Taste wise?

We tried the Honeycomb and vanilla flavour, which was nice, but I can’t help but feel like there was something missing. Maybe, I was secretly hoping for a crunchie style honeycomb hit, but instead it was more like eating a fudge bar (which I definitely still enjoy).

Overall, I’d rate them pretty highly for their good value, good texture and convenientness. They made the perfect snack to chuck in my gym bag ready for the post-weight crash.

High Protein Bar Nutrition

With great macro ratios, these tasty bars contain 30g of Protein, but what about the rest?

Macros per 80g bar:

Protein: 30g
Carbohydrates: 24g (10g of which are from fibre)
Fat: 6.3g

Per 100g Per flapjack (80g)
Energy 1347kJ/328 kcal 1099kJ/263 kcal
Fat 7.9 g 6.3 g
of which saturates 5.1 g 4 g
Carbohydrate 29g 24g
of which sugars 4.7 g 3.8 g
Protein 38g 30g
Salt 0.7 g 0.56 g

These High protein bars are a great way to hit your nutritional goals, without going overboard on sugar.
